Public Consultation- Amendments to Securities (General) Bye-Laws and CIS Bye-Laws

The Trinidad and Tobago Securities and Exchange Commission (“the Commission”) proposes to issue an amendment to the Schedule 1 of the Securities (General) By-Laws 2015 and Schedule 1 of the Securities (Collective Investment Schemes) Bye-Laws 2023 (“the Fee Schedules”).

The amendments to the Fee Schedules seek to adjust fees that allows the Commission the capabilities to discharge its functions under Section 6 of the Securities Act 2012 (“the Act”).

The Commission hereby provides notice that the draft Fee Schedules are now available for public comment. This amendment is being proposed under section 148 of the Securities Act, Chapter 83:02 of the Laws of the Republic of Trinidad and Tobago.

All comments can be forwarded to prp@ttsec.org.tt.

Note, the consultation period is  December 10th, 2024 to January 24th 2025.
